Types of Automobile Keys
Automobile keys have evolved significantly over the years, transitioning from easy mechanical keys to innovative electronic ones. Understanding the different types of keys can assist owners understand what to anticipate when it concerns replacement.
Kind of Key
Description
Typical Models
Mechanical Key
A conventional metal key used to unlock and start the car.
Older designs, some economical cars
Transponder Key
A key with a chip that sends out a signal to the car's ignition system, boosting security.
Lots of mid-range and high-end automobiles
Remote Key Fob
A key with buttons for locking/unlocking and other functions, frequently with a transponder chip.
The majority of modern-day lorries
Smart Key
A keyless entry system that permits chauffeurs to begin the car without physically placing a key.
Luxury and hybrid models
Valet Key
A limited-use key that allows parking attendants access to the vehicle without full opportunities.
Various designs
The Key Replacement Process
Replacing an automobile key generally includes numerous actions. This process can differ a little depending on the kind of key and the vehicle design, however key replacement generally follows this summary:
- Identification: The very first action is validating ownership of the vehicle. Evidence of ownership, such as the vehicle's registration and recognition, will be needed.
- Evaluation: A locksmith or car dealership specialist will assess the kind of key required for replacement, figuring out whether it is mechanical, transponder-based, or a smart key.
- Programs: For electronic keys, particularly transponder and smart keys, programming is necessary. This action synchronizes the new key with the vehicle's onboard computer.
- Cutting: If the key is mechanical or transponder-based, a new key will require to be cut to match the original.
- Testing: Once the new key is made and programmed, it is evaluated to ensure it operates properly.
Factors Influencing Replacement Costs
The expense of changing an automobile key can differ widely based on a number of elements:
Factor
Description
Average Cost Estimate
Kind of Key
Complex keys like clever keys are generally more expensive than standard mechanical keys.
₤ 50 - ₤ 500
Vehicle Make/Model
High-end automobiles typically have higher replacement expenses due to specialized keys and programs.
₤ 100 - ₤ 700
Place
The geographical place can influence labor rates and service accessibility.
₤ 50 - ₤ 150
Service Provider
Dealerships tend to be more costly than local locksmiths.
₤ 75 - ₤ 500
Emergency Services
After-hours or emergency situation key replacement services can sustain extra costs.
₤ 100 - ₤ 300
Average Cost of Key Replacement by Type
Kind of Key
Average Replacement Cost
Mechanical Key
₤ 10 - ₤ 50
Transponder Key
₤ 50 - ₤ 150
Remote Key Fob
₤ 100 - ₤ 300
Smart Key
₤ 200 - ₤ 500
Valet Key
₤ 10 - ₤ 40

For how long does it take to replace an automobile key?
- The replacement procedure can take anywhere from 15 minutes to an hour, depending upon the complexity of the key.

Will my car still work if I have a dead key fob battery?
- Most key fobs have a manual key covert inside them that can be used to open the door and start the vehicle, offered you can access the ignition.
